Ang Lee

A Taiwanese filmmaker whose work crosses languages and genres while returning to restrained emotion and social expectation. He has combined intimate drama with ambitious visual filmmaking.

Early life

Taiwan education

Studied at Taiwan’s arts college before moving to the United States.

American training

Studied theatre at Illinois and filmmaking at New York University.

Career

  1. 1991–1994

    Family trilogy

    Made Pushing Hands, The Wedding Banquet and Eat Drink Man Woman.

  2. 1995

    English-language breakthrough

    Directed Sense and Sensibility.

  3. 2000–2005

    International successes

    Made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on and Brokeback Mountain.

  4. 2012

    Life of Pi

    Combined a survival story with extensive digital imagery.

Selected work

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on

Brought wuxia action and restrained romance to a broad international audience.

Brokeback Mountain

Told a decades-long relationship shaped by social constraint.

Life of Pi

A visually elaborate story of survival and belief.

Beyond directing

Technical experiments

Explored 3D and high-frame-rate filmmaking.

Family

His wife Jane Lin supported the family during years before his directing breakthrough.
